By Kim-Mai Cutler Urban construction and development is about as far as you can get from an easily scalable business. Designs from architects are usually bespoke or one-off. Land-use politics are unpredictable. Individual construction sites are uniquely sized and materials can change from building to building. So cost overruns are the norm, rather than the exception.
